摘要

Additional testing of the small gas turbine/pressurized fluidized bed (SGT/PFB) Technology Unit that has been accomplished. The new 3-stage hot gas cleanup system evaluation indicates improvements are required. Modification to the first and second stage cyclones are in process. A 150-hour endurance/baseline test on the Rover gas turbine engine was completed. The Pilot Plant design continues. However PFB structural design awaits further technology rig testing to establish final definition of hot gas cleanup system. The procurement of long lead raw materials and of engineering drawings for material handling equipment continues. (ERA citation 08:044461)
